several
Universal Words
determiner, pronoun, adjective
determiner, pronoun more than two but not very many:
Several letters arrived this morning. * He's written several books about India. * Several more people than usual came to the meeting. * If you're looking for a photo of Alice you'll find several in here. * Several of the paintings were destroyed in the fire.
adjective (formal) separate:
They said goodbye and went their several ways.
